What Are Bid Bonds?



A bid bond is a sort of guaranty bond that acts as an economic guarantee in between a task owner and a bidder. It makes certain that the prospective buyer will certainly become part of the agreement at the proposal price and offer the required efficiency and repayment bonds if awarded the contract. Bid bonds are typically used in building jobs, where they offer to prequalify professionals and guarantee the seriousness and financial capability of the bidding entity.


At its core, a bid bond supplies defense to the job proprietor by mitigating dangers related to the bidding process. If a prospective buyer, after winning the agreement, falls short to start the job according to the bid terms, the job proprietor can claim compensation approximately the bond's worth. This countervailing device covers the extra prices sustained by the proprietor to award the agreement to the following least expensive prospective buyer or to reinitiate the bidding procedure.


Fundamentally, quote bonds foster an equal opportunity in affordable bidding environments, ensuring that just financially stable and major bidders get involved. They likewise contribute to the total stability and performance of the purchase process, giving a layer of safety and count on in between project owners and specialists.


How Bid Bonds Work



Recognizing the auto mechanics of bid bonds is vital for stakeholders in the building sector. A quote bond is a sort of surety bond released by a surety business, ensuring that the prospective buyer will honor the regards to their bid if granted the agreement. It serves as an economic assurance to the task owner that the prospective buyer has the economic ability and intent to undertake the job at the recommended bid rate.


To procure a proposal bond, a service provider needs to put on a surety firm, offering financial statements, credit rating, and details concerning the project. The guaranty business after that analyzes the danger connected with issuing the bond. Upon approval, the guaranty issues the bond to the specialist, that submits it together with their quote proposal.

If the specialist is awarded the contract yet falls short to become part of the arrangement or offer the needed performance and repayment bonds, the task owner can assert the quote bond. The guaranty business then makes up the task proprietor as much as the bond's worth, normally a percentage of the bid quantity, commonly 5-10%. This ensures that the project owner is safeguarded from monetary loss as a result of non-compliance by the winning bidder, maintaining the honesty of the affordable bidding procedure.

Typical Misunderstandings



One widespread misunderstanding is that quote bonds assure the contractor will win my latest blog post the task. In reality, a bid bond merely makes sure that the specialist, if picked, will certainly get in into the contract and offer the called for efficiency and repayment bonds.


Another typical misunderstanding is the idea that bid bonds are unnecessary for tiny or uncomplicated tasks. No matter task dimension, quote bonds serve as a protective step for project owners, making sure economically steady and major quotes. Avoiding this step can jeopardize the honesty of the bidding procedure and may disqualify a service provider from consideration.


Finally, some service providers presume that quote bonds are a financial concern due to their price (Bid Bonds). The price of a quote bond is typically a small percent of the proposal quantity and is a beneficial financial investment for the possibility to protect a project. This small cost ought to be viewed as a necessary element of carrying out organization, not an avoidable expense.
